Following the approval of the Darwin Core RDF Guide by the executive on
2015-03-27, I feel that my major contributions to the RDF TG have been
completed. I have now taken up new responsibilities as the convener of
the TDWG Vocabulary Maintenance Specification Task Group
(
https://github.com/tdwg/vocab). Therefore, I feel that it is best that
I resign as co-convener of the RDF Task Group in order to devote my time
and attention to the new group. The RDF task group will remain in the
capable hands of my co-convener Joel Sachs and I hope to continue
contributing to the RDF TG as a key member. Thank you for all of your
work, input, and support as we moved the RDF Guide from conception to
inclusion in the Darwin Core standard.
